**Mgmt Meeting Minutes — Retiring the Brightline Range**

Quick recap for sales leads at Fenholt Supplies: we agreed to retire the Brightline fixture range by year-end. Remaining stock moves to clearance pricing next month, and accounts on standing orders get migrated to the Lumetta range. Trade-in incentives were approved in principle. The confidential note on next steps sits just below.

board note of bajof-bajeg: The pricing group signed off on a budget of $13.4 million for Project Sildor. The renewal with Lamixek Holdings closes at $48.9 million a year, 49 percent above the last contract.

Plugin authors: don't hardcode archive thresholds in your ColdVault hooks. The core scheduler already decides when a bucket goes cold — your plugin just gets the callback. Overriding age cutoffs here caused the Renlow plugin to archive live buckets last quarter. Read the values from config instead; they're centrally tuned and may change per deployment tier. If you need different behavior, file a proposal. For reference, the current defaults are listed below.

tuning constants:
WEIGHTS = {
    "wendor": 631,
    "norir": 625,
    "julael": 998,
}

Meeting notes — facilities, excerpt. Item 4: replacement lock for the records safe. The new lock unit from Ironquill Security has cleared inspection and is packed for transfer to the Delmont office. Agreed the move happens Thursday morning, single courier, no intermediate stops. The old lock stays in place until the fitter confirms arrival. For the courier hand-over itself, follow the confidential instruction below.

courier memo of bawif-fahof: the oliix novwyn courier leaves the holok holir wendor ledger at gate 8732 under passcode 371313